分享好友 数智知识首页 数智知识分类 切换频道

Eclipse IDE 可视化界面开发实战指南

Eclipse IDE 是一款功能强大的集成开发环境(IDE),它支持多种编程语言和框架,广泛应用于软件开发领域。在Eclipse IDE 中进行可视化界面开发,可以大大提高工作效率。以下是一篇关于使用Eclipse IDE 进行可视化界面开发的实战指南。...
2025-04-17 02:18130

Eclipse IDE 是一款功能强大的集成开发环境(IDE),它支持多种编程语言和框架,广泛应用于软件开发领域。在Eclipse IDE 中进行可视化界面开发,可以大大提高工作效率。以下是一篇关于使用Eclipse IDE 进行可视化界面开发的实战指南:

1. 安装Eclipse IDE

在开始之前,请确保您已经安装了Eclipse IDE。可以从官方网站下载并安装最新版本的Eclipse,以获得最佳体验。

2. 创建新项目

启动Eclipse IDE,点击“File”菜单中的“New”选项,选择“Project”,然后输入项目名称和保存位置。接下来,选择“Java”作为项目类型,并点击“Next”按钮继续。根据您的需求选择合适的包名、类名等设置,然后点击“Finish”按钮完成新项目的创建。

3. 创建Java类文件

在项目目录下,右键单击空白区域,选择“New”选项,然后选择“Class”来创建一个Java类文件。为该类文件命名并为其添加相应的注释,以便后续开发时能够更好地理解代码逻辑。

4. 编写Java代码

在Java类文件中,编写您的程序代码。可以使用Eclipse IDE提供的语法高亮功能,帮助您更轻松地编写代码。同时,可以通过“Run As”菜单中的“Java Application”选项来运行您的程序,以检查代码是否正常运行。

5. 设计用户界面

为了实现可视化界面开发,需要使用Eclipse IDE提供的图形化工具。首先,打开“Window”菜单,选择“Preferences”选项,然后在弹出的窗口中勾选“General”选项卡下的“Editors”复选框。接着,在左侧的“Editors”列表中展开“Text Editors”文件夹,找到“Java”编辑器,双击将其设置为默认编辑器。

6. 使用图形化工具创建界面元素

Eclipse IDE 可视化界面开发实战指南

在Eclipse IDE中,可以使用各种图形化工具来创建界面元素,如按钮、文本框、标签等。这些工具提供了丰富的样式和属性设置,可以根据实际需求进行调整和定制。

7. 连接事件监听器

为了使界面元素能够响应用户操作,需要在Java代码中添加事件监听器。通过继承JButton等类,可以实现对按钮等界面元素的点击事件监听。当用户点击按钮等界面元素时,事件监听器会自动触发相应的操作。

8. 测试和调试

为确保界面开发的正确性和稳定性,需要进行测试和调试。在Eclipse IDE中,可以使用“Debug”菜单中的“Start Debugging”选项来启动调试模式。在调试模式下,可以逐行执行代码,查看变量值的变化以及程序的运行状态。同时,可以使用“View”菜单中的“Stack”选项来查看堆栈信息,帮助定位问题所在。

9. 优化界面设计

在界面开发过程中,需要注意界面的美观性和可读性。可以通过调整布局、字体大小、颜色等参数来优化界面设计。同时,建议将常用的功能模块放置在页面上方便访问的位置,以提高用户的使用体验。

10. 发布和部署应用程序

完成应用程序的开发后,需要将其打包发布到服务器或客户端进行部署。在Eclipse IDE中,可以使用“Package”菜单中的“Export”选项来导出项目文件,并将其部署到服务器或客户端中。同时,还可以通过“Run As”菜单中的“Deployment”选项来部署应用程序到服务器或客户端。

11. 持续学习和改进

可视化界面开发是一个不断发展的过程,需要不断学习和掌握新的技术和方法。建议关注Eclipse官方文档和社区资源,了解最新的版本更新和功能特点。同时,可以尝试使用其他可视化开发工具,如IntelliJ IDEA、Visual Studio等,以拓宽自己的技术视野和提高开发效率。

总之,使用Eclipse IDE进行可视化界面开发需要遵循一定的步骤和方法。通过以上指南的学习,相信您已经掌握了Eclipse IDE的基本使用方法和可视化界面开发技巧。在今后的开发过程中,希望您能够灵活运用所学知识,不断提升自己的技术能力和开发水平。

举报
收藏 0
推荐产品更多
蓝凌MK

智能、协同、安全、高效蓝凌MK数智化工作平台全面支撑组织数智化可持续发展Gartner预测,组装式企业在实施新功能方面能力超80%竞争对手。未来,企业亟需基于“封装业务能力”(Packaged Business Capability,简称PBC)理念,将传统OA及业务系统全面升级为组...

帆软FineBI

数据分析,一气呵成数据准备可连接多种数据源,一键接入数据库表或导入Excel数据编辑可视化编辑数据,过滤合并计算,完全不需要SQL数据可视化内置50+图表和联动钻取特效,可视化呈现数据故事分享协作可多人协同编辑仪表板,复用他人报表,一键分享发布比传统...

悟空CRM

为什么客户选择悟空CRM?悟空CRM为您提供全方位服务客户管理的主要功能客户管理,把控全局悟空CRM助力销售全流程,通过对客户初始信息、跟进过程、 关联商机、合同等的全流程管理,与客户建立紧密的联系, 帮助销售统筹规划每一步,赢得强有力的竞争力优势。...

简道云

丰富模板,安装即用200+应用模板,既提供标准化管理方案,也支持零代码个性化修改低成本、快速地搭建企业级管理应用通过功能组合,灵活实现数据在不同场景下的:采集-流转-处理-分析应用表单个性化通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行...

推荐知识更多